我试图简化插入数据到我的数据库的过程中,所以我已经构造了一个模型,把手可变提取和数据插入。

据我所知,这种模式体现了一个函数,然后调用此函数(如/控制器/模型),并通过模型进行处理通过相关的数据。不过,我不确定如何把模型,而如何调用它,或者需要写这样我就可以调用该函数什么。我使用笨

这里的所述模型:

class Createproject extends ActiveRecord {

function __insert() // This function will handle inserting the relevant project information into the database.
    {

        $this->project_name = $this->input->get_post('project_name');

        // ... skipping ~30 variable definitions ...

        $this->db->insert('project_details', $this);
    }

所以我在这里混淆;你在哪里把这个模型进行处理,你将如何使用它的控制器或应用程序的其余部分中?

谢谢!

有帮助吗?

解决方案

你可以导入(require_once)到你的控制器(保存成models.php),并在你的控制器实例吧:

$cp = new Createproject()
$cp->__insert()
许可以下: CC-BY-SA归因
不隶属于 StackOverflow
scroll top